标签:
<?xml version="1.0" encoding="UTF-8"?> <!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http://mybatis.org/dtd/mybatis-3-config.dtd"> <configuration> <!-- 类型的别名 --> <typeAliases> <typeAlias type="com.iflytek.entity.User" alias="User"/> <typeAlias type="com.iflytek.entity.Department" alias="Department"/> </typeAliases> <environments default="mysql"> <environment id="mysql"> <!-- 事务管理 JDBC/MANAGER --> <transactionManager type="JDBC"></transactionManager> <!-- pool:连接池 UNPOOLED --> <dataSource type="POOLED"> <property name="driver" value="com.mysql.jdbc.Driver"/> <property name="url" value="jdbc:mysql://localhost:3306/test"/> <property name="username" value="root"/> <property name="password" value="root"/> </dataSource> </environment> <environment id="sqlserver"> <!-- 事务管理 JDBC/MANAGER --> <transactionManager type="JDBC"></transactionManager> <!-- pool:连接池 --> <dataSource type="POOLED"> <property name="driver" value="com.microsoft.sqlserver.jdbc.SQLServerDriver"/> <property name="url" value="jdbc:sqlserver://localhost:1433;databaseName=test2"/> <property name="username" value="sa"/> <property name="password" value="sa"/> </dataSource> </environment> </environments> <!-- 配置每个表的映射文件 --> <mappers> <mapper resource="com/iflytek/entity/User.xml"/> <mapper resource="com/iflytek/entity/Department.xml"/> </mappers> </configuration>
这个文件的要放在src目录下
作用:
1.子xml文件需要根据全路径(如:com.iflytek.entity.User)引入类名,这里可以给这个长长的类名取别名
2.数据库环境配置(可配置多个环境)
3.配置子xml文件(实体类的映射文件)
标签:
原文地址:http://www.cnblogs.com/-captain/p/4995562.html